No buyers over Christmas it would seem (no surprise and my bad for trying) so here we go again. I'm a long time member of the Surrey TRF and this bike has only been used on the lanes, never raced or used at any events.
I am the only owner. The bike was supplied new to me by KTM Centre Hemel.
It has done 122 hours and has been maintained regardless of cost, eg 1 ride ago it had new pads all round and Supersprox Stealth sprocket set and RK 520 O ring chain at extreme cost. Only ever run on on Putoline MX9 oil.
It's got some (necessary?) bling;
Mousses front and rear
KTM clutch saver
KTM 20mm bar risers
KTM carbon pipe guard
KTM plastic skid plate
KTM aluminium rad guards
Cycra pro bend hand guards
KTM Fork bleeders
FMF Gnarly Pipe
KTM low seat available by separate negotition.
All the other bits and bobs (KTM folder etc) and some spares.
